Output 9134b123022d52ccc724efd7af9ce693a6e8df671cd95987baf16c8cb33e8b51:1

value
516697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5c842e3c18cfb8aae43696141fc0d5228ed4282 OP_EQUAL
address
3JGC8fRViPqSgTxAQEU7oMSeHw8JXtZDFN
transaction
9134b123022d52ccc724efd7af9ce693a6e8df671cd95987baf16c8cb33e8b51
confirmations
266206
spent
true